未捕获的错误:[$ injector:modulerr] http://errors.angularjs.org/1.4.3/$injector/modulerr

时间:2015-08-09 04:35:07

标签: javascript jquery angularjs angularjs-directive angularjs-scope

以下是我编写的代码的错误消息。我在错误消息后提到了代码。我是新人,需要帮助!!

  

未捕获的SyntaxError:意外的令牌{angular.min.js:6

     

未捕获错误:[$ injector:modulerr]   http://errors.angularjs.org/1.4.3/ $注射器/ modulerr P0 = mainApp&安培; P1 =错误%3A ... A%2F%2Flocalhost%3A8084%2FAngularProject%2FLib%2Fangular.min.js%3A19%3A339)(匿名   函数)@ angular.min.js:6(匿名函数)@ angular.min.js:38m   @ angular.min.js:7g @ angular.min.js:37eb @ angular.min.js:40d @   angular.min.js:19Ac @ angular.min.js:20Zd @   angular.min.js:18(匿名函数)@ angular.min.js:289a @   angular.min.js:176c @ angular.min.js:35"

<script src="Lib/angular.min.js" type="text/javascript"></script>
        <script src="Lib/angular-route.js" type="text/javascript"></script>
        <script>
            var demoApp=angular.module('mainApp',[ngRoute]);

            demoApp.config(function($routeProvider){
                $routeProvider
                        .when('/',
                {
                    controller:'SimpleController',
                    templateUrl:'view1.html'
                })
                        .when('/view1',{
                            controller:'SimpleController',
                            templateUrl:'/view.html'
                })
                        .otherwise({redirectTo:'/'});
            });

            demoApp.controller('SimpleController',function($scope){
            $scope.customers=[
            {name:'Joe',city:'Toronto'},
            {name:'Jane',city:'Sydney'},
            {name:'Roberto',city:'Vienna'},
            {name:'Kumiko',city:'Japan'}
           ];

           $scope.addCustomer=funtion(){
             $scope.customers.push({name:$scope.newCustomer.name,city:$scope.newCustomer.city});  
           };
        });/*
            function SimpleController($scope){
                $scope.customers=[
                    {name:'Sabin',city:'Bhaktapur'},
                    {name:'Abhi',city:'Lalitpur'},
                    {name:'shree',city:'Kathmandu'},
                    {name:'rameshwor',city:'Bhojpur'}
                   ];
            }*/
        </script>

1 个答案:

答案 0 :(得分:3)

ngRoute应该在引号中:

var demoApp=angular.module('mainApp',['ngRoute']);